質問編集履歴
1
マークダウンが使えるようなので一部修正
title
CHANGED
File without changes
|
body
CHANGED
@@ -1,6 +1,7 @@
|
|
1
1
|
現在、以下のようなマルチプロジェクトの構成で、下記に記載の手順でビルドを行なっています。
|
2
2
|
common以外のサブプロジェクトはcommonのみを参照しています。
|
3
3
|
|
4
|
+
```
|
4
5
|
service-root
|
5
6
|
∟ common
|
6
7
|
∟ api-1
|
@@ -9,6 +10,7 @@
|
|
9
10
|
∟ worker
|
10
11
|
∟ admin-1
|
11
12
|
∟ admin-2
|
13
|
+
```
|
12
14
|
|
13
15
|
drone上でシングルにcommonから順番にビルドとユニットテストを実行していきます。それが全サブプロジェクトで完了したら、jar を作成し、社内リポジトリにアップロードします。
|
14
16
|
この一連のビルドに1時間掛かっています。
|